The Ampper Top Post Battery Disconnect Switch is a robust 12V, 125A rated isolator designed for quick and safe battery disconnection on vehicles, RVs, and boats. Featuring a corrosion-resistant stainless steel build with IP65 protection, it fits standard 15-17mm top post terminals and offers a simple knob control to prevent power drain and extend battery life.

Good except the post is tapered.
Killswitch works fine. 5 rotations and the connection is restored or severed.Took about 5 minutes to install and required a 13mm and 10mm socket. 13mm to attach the killswitch to the battery post, and the 10mm to attach the cable to the killswitch post. The killswitch post is tapered, and I needed to build it up by wrapping some bare telephone copper about a dozen times around the post, then tightened the cable all the way; seems to hold up and connection is solid.If you have a tight space, this might not work for you as the top of the knob is almost a full inch, 20mm above the top of the battery post and sticks out ~3".
